In the ever-evolving digital world, having a robust online presence is essential for any business or individual. One of the critical components of building this presence is choosing the right web hosting service. As of February 2021, it was reported that WordPress powers 40% of the top 10 million websites globally, highlighting its popularity in the realm of web hosting solutions. In this comprehensive guide, we will explore the essentials of selecting the perfect web hosting service, ensuring you make an informed decision tailored to your specific needs.
Understanding What Web Hosting Is
Web hosting is an essential service for anyone looking to establish a presence on the Internet, be it an individual, a business, or an organisation. At its core, web hosting is a service that enables your website to be accessible online. This service is provided by web hosts or hosting service providers, who offer the necessary technologies and infrastructure for your website to be viewed on the Internet.
When you host a website, its files are stored on powerful computers known as servers. When someone wants to visit your website, they type your domain name into their web browser. This action sends a request to your web host’s server, which then delivers your website’s files back to the user’s browser, allowing them to view your site.
Web hosting comes in various forms, tailored to different needs and levels of expertise. The most straightforward type is shared hosting, where multiple websites share the same server resources, making it a cost-effective option for beginners and small businesses. For those needing more control and resources, options like dedicated hosting, VPS hosting, and cloud hosting are available, each offering varying levels of performance, flexibility, and scalability.
Additionally, web hosts provide a range of services that go beyond merely storing files. These include domain registration, email hosting, and website building tools, which can significantly ease the process of setting up and maintaining a website. Security features such as SSL certificates, backups, and firewalls are also typically offered to protect your data and ensure your website runs smoothly.
Understanding the fundamentals of web hosting can help you make informed decisions, ensuring your website performs optimally and remains accessible to your audience at all times.
Different Types of Web Hosting Services
Web hosting services come in various forms, each designed to cater to specific needs and technical proficiencies. Understanding the differences can help you select the most suitable option for your website.
Shared hosting is an economical choice where multiple websites share the same server resources. This type of hosting is ideal for small businesses, personal blogs, and beginners due to its cost-effectiveness and ease of management. However, because resources are shared, performance may fluctuate based on the traffic of other websites on the server.
For those needing more control and dedicated resources, dedicated hosting is the way to go. With this type of hosting, you rent an entire server exclusively for your website, ensuring optimal performance and security. It’s perfect for large businesses and websites with high traffic demands.
VPS (Virtual Private Server) hosting offers a middle ground between shared and dedicated hosting. It partitions a single physical server into multiple virtual servers, providing more control, scalability, and better performance compared to shared hosting. It’s a suitable option for growing businesses that need more resources without the cost of a dedicated server.
Cloud hosting is a modern solution that utilises a network of interconnected servers to host websites. This allows for high flexibility and scalability, as resources can be easily adjusted according to your website’s traffic. It’s particularly beneficial for websites with variable traffic patterns, as it ensures consistent performance and reliability.
By understanding the distinct features and benefits of each web hosting type, you can make an informed decision that aligns with your specific requirements, ensuring your website operates smoothly and efficiently.
Key Features to Look for in a Web Hosting Provider
Selecting the ideal web hosting provider necessitates a detailed examination of several critical features. One of the foremost aspects to consider is uptime reliability. An excellent provider should guarantee a minimum of 99.9% uptime to ensure your website remains accessible at all times. Speed is another crucial factor, impacting both user experience and search engine optimisation (SEO). Opt for a provider that utilises high-performance servers and fast load times to keep your site running smoothly.
Security is paramount in today’s digital landscape. A reputable web hosting provider should offer robust security measures, including SSL certificates for data encryption, firewalls to block malicious attacks, and regular malware scans. Additionally, features such as automatic backups are essential for safeguarding your data against potential loss.
User-friendly control panels, such as cPanel or custom solutions, are vital for efficiently managing your hosting account. These interfaces should offer intuitive navigation and a range of functionalities, including domain management, email account creation, and application installations.
Multiple data centre locations are beneficial for improving your website’s performance and reliability. Hosting providers with geographically diverse data centres can deliver content faster to users across different regions, enhancing the overall user experience.
Scalability is another key feature to look for. Your hosting provider should offer flexible plans that can grow with your needs, allowing you to upgrade resources seamlessly as your website’s traffic increases. This ensures that your site remains performant and reliable, even during peak traffic periods.
Lastly, evaluate the quality of customer support. Accessible and knowledgeable support teams can assist in resolving issues promptly, preventing prolonged downtime and mitigating potential disruptions. Look for providers that offer 24/7 support through multiple channels such as live chat, email, and phone.
How to Assess Web Hosting Performance
When assessing web hosting performance, several critical factors come into play. Start by examining server response times and page load speeds, as these are fundamental to user experience and search engine rankings. Utilise tools like GTmetrix or Pingdom to monitor these metrics and gain insights into your website’s performance.
Delve into the quality of the hosting provider’s infrastructure. This includes evaluating their data centres, the technology they use, and their network’s robustness. Ensure that they employ a robust content delivery network (CDN) to improve site performance across various geographical locations.
Another essential aspect is uptime reliability. Check for a hosting provider that guarantees a minimum of 99.9% uptime, ensuring that your website remains accessible consistently. Any downtime can result in lost traffic and potential revenue, so it’s crucial to opt for a provider with a proven track record of high uptime.
Scalability is a key performance indicator. Your hosting provider should offer the ability to scale resources seamlessly to handle traffic spikes and growth. This flexibility ensures that your website can maintain optimal performance, even during peak times.
Additionally, examine the security measures in place. Performance is not just about speed and uptime; it’s also about ensuring that your website runs smoothly without disruptions from cyber threats. Look for features like SSL certificates, firewalls, and regular malware scans to safeguard your site.
Lastly, consider the customer support quality. Quick and effective support can significantly impact how well your site performs, especially when technical issues arise. Choose a provider known for excellent customer service to help you address any performance-related concerns promptly.
The Importance of Web Hosting Security
In the digital age, the security of your web hosting environment is not just an option; it’s a necessity. Cyber threats are evolving, and without robust security measures, your website and sensitive data could be at significant risk. A top-tier hosting provider should prioritise your website’s security, incorporating multiple layers of protection to safeguard against malicious attacks and data breaches.
Begin by looking for hosts that offer comprehensive security features, including SSL certificates. SSL encryption ensures that data transmitted between your website and its users is secure, fostering trust and protecting sensitive information such as login credentials and payment details. Regular malware scanning is another crucial service, as it helps detect and eliminate potential threats before they can cause harm.
Firewalls are an essential component, acting as a barrier to prevent unauthorised access to your server. They monitor incoming and outgoing traffic, blocking any suspicious activities. Automatic backups are also indispensable, allowing you to restore your website to a previous state in case of a cyber-attack or data loss.
Another vital aspect is the isolation of accounts. This means that even if one website on a shared server is compromised, the others remain unaffected. Two-factor authentication adds an extra layer of security, requiring a second form of verification beyond just a password.
Additionally, evaluate the provider’s policies on security updates and patches. Regular updates ensure that any vulnerabilities are addressed promptly, keeping your website protected against the latest threats.
Choosing a web hosting provider that prioritises security not only protects your website but also enhances your users’ trust and confidence, fostering a safer online environment for everyone.
Comparing Costs: Getting Value for Your Money
When selecting a web hosting service, cost is undoubtedly a significant factor. However, it’s crucial to balance affordability with the value provided. Opting for the cheapest plan might save money initially, but it could compromise essential features like robust security measures, reliable customer support, and sufficient resources.
Begin by assessing what is included in the price. A slightly more expensive plan may offer comprehensive security features such as SSL certificates and firewalls, which can prevent costly data breaches. Additionally, check whether the plan includes automatic backups and malware scans, which are invaluable for maintaining your website’s integrity.
Customer support is another critical element to consider. In the event of technical difficulties, having access to a knowledgeable support team can save both time and money. Providers offering 24/7 support through various channels—live chat, email, and phone—tend to be more reliable and can promptly address issues, preventing prolonged downtime.
Scalability is also a significant consideration. As your website grows, you may require more resources. Investing in a scalable hosting plan ensures you can upgrade seamlessly without encountering performance bottlenecks or disruptions.
Evaluate any additional perks that might come with your hosting plan, such as free domain registration, email hosting, or website building tools. These added benefits can provide excellent value, making a slightly higher cost worthwhile.
Lastly, consider the hosting provider’s reputation and reliability. Look at reviews and testimonials to gauge the experiences of other users. A reputable provider with a solid track record can offer peace of mind, ensuring that your investment translates into a dependable, high-performing website.
Understanding Bandwidth and Storage Needs
Understanding your website’s bandwidth and storage needs is crucial in selecting an appropriate web hosting plan. Bandwidth represents the volume of data transferred between your site and its visitors over a specific period. High-traffic websites, especially those featuring rich multimedia content, require substantial bandwidth to ensure smooth performance and an optimal user experience. Conversely, smaller sites or blogs with minimal traffic might need less bandwidth. Monitoring your traffic patterns and anticipating growth can help you choose a plan that accommodates both your current and future needs.
Storage, meanwhile, pertains to the amount of space your website’s files, databases, and emails occupy on the server. Websites with extensive content—such as high-resolution images, videos, or large databases—require more storage space. It’s essential to evaluate your site’s content and future plans for expansion when determining your storage requirements.
When selecting a web hosting plan, consider the potential for scalability. Opt for a provider that allows easy upgrades to higher bandwidth and storage capacities as your website grows. This flexibility can prevent the need for a costly migration to a new host in the future.
Additionally, be mindful of any restrictions or limitations imposed by the hosting provider. Some plans may offer “unlimited” bandwidth and storage, but it’s vital to read the fine print to understand any fair usage policies or potential extra costs for exceeding set limits.
How to Migrate Your Website to a New Host
Migrating your website to a new host requires meticulous planning to ensure a smooth transition. First, select your new hosting provider and create an account. Ensure that you have a full backup of your website’s files and databases. This precaution safeguards against potential data loss during the migration process.
Next, transfer your website’s files to the new server. This can typically be done using an FTP client or the file manager provided by your new host. Carefully upload all the necessary files and databases to the new server, ensuring that everything is correctly placed and intact.
Once the files are transferred, update your domain’s DNS settings to point to your new hosting provider. This step is crucial as it redirects your visitors to the new server. DNS propagation can take up to 48 hours, so it’s advisable to schedule the migration during a low-traffic period to minimise disruptions.
During this propagation period, thoroughly test your website to confirm that all functionalities are working correctly. Check for broken links, missing images, and ensure that all forms and scripts are functioning as intended. Testing is vital to identify and rectify any issues promptly.
Lastly, communicate the migration to your users if necessary. Inform them of any expected downtime or changes to their user experience. This transparency helps maintain trust and ensures a smooth user experience post-migration.
Consider opting for a hosting provider that offers migration services to simplify the process and provide professional assistance, ensuring that your website is efficiently transferred without any hitches.
Evaluating Customer Support Services
When evaluating web hosting providers, the quality of customer support should be a top priority. Excellent support can be the difference between a minor hiccup and a major disruption. A good starting point is to investigate the provider’s available support channels. Look for options such as live chat, email, and phone support. The more channels available, the better, as this offers flexibility depending on your situation and preference.
It’s crucial to check the availability of support services. Opt for providers that offer 24/7 support, ensuring assistance is available whenever you need it, regardless of time zones or emergencies. Response time is another vital factor. Fast response times can significantly minimise downtime and related frustrations.
Reading customer reviews and testimonials can offer insights into the provider’s support quality. Look for comments on how efficiently and effectively issues were resolved. Additionally, consider whether the provider offers a comprehensive knowledge base or FAQs section. These resources can be invaluable for troubleshooting common issues on your own, saving time and potentially resolving problems without the need for direct support.
The expertise of the support team also matters. Providers with knowledgeable and well-trained staff can offer more accurate and helpful advice, speeding up the resolution process and enhancing your overall experience.
Understanding the Role of Control Panels
Control panels are indispensable tools in the management of your web hosting account, offering a streamlined and user-friendly interface for a myriad of tasks. These interfaces facilitate the management of domains, the creation of email accounts, and the installation of various applications, making web hosting more accessible to users with varying levels of technical expertise.
One of the most widely recognised control panels is cPanel. Celebrated for its intuitive design and comprehensive range of features, cPanel simplifies complex tasks such as database management, file transfers, and backup scheduling. It provides a clear, graphical interface that allows users to perform essential administrative functions without needing to delve into complicated command-line operations.
Many hosting providers also develop custom control panels tailored to their specific services. These bespoke interfaces can offer unique functionalities or streamlined processes that are particularly well-suited to the provider’s infrastructure and user base. When choosing a web hosting provider, it’s important to evaluate the control panel’s usability and feature set.
A robust control panel can significantly enhance your efficiency in managing your website, providing you with tools that simplify administrative tasks, improve security measures, and ensure optimal website performance. Therefore, the choice of control panel should be a key consideration when selecting a web hosting provider, as it can impact your overall experience and operational ease.
Considering Eco-Friendly Web Hosting Options
In today’s environmentally conscious landscape, eco-friendly web hosting options are gaining traction as businesses seek to reduce their carbon footprint. These green hosting providers employ renewable energy sources, such as wind or solar power, to run their data centres. Additionally, they often implement energy-efficient practices like advanced cooling systems and optimised server usage to further minimise environmental impact.
Choosing an eco-friendly web hosting provider not only demonstrates a commitment to sustainability but also aligns your brand with the growing movement towards environmental responsibility. This can enhance your reputation and appeal to environmentally aware customers who prioritise green initiatives.
When evaluating eco-friendly hosting options, consider the provider’s specific practices and certifications. Look for those who are transparent about their energy sources and efficiency measures. Providers that participate in carbon offset programmes or invest in renewable energy credits are also commendable choices.
Integrating eco-friendly hosting into your business operations can be a significant step towards a more sustainable future, reflecting your dedication to both technological advancement and environmental stewardship.
Reviews and Testimonials: Making an Informed Decision
When selecting a web hosting provider, reviews and testimonials serve as invaluable resources for gauging the quality and reliability of the service. They offer firsthand insights from other users, helping you assess whether a particular provider aligns with your needs and expectations.
Begin by exploring feedback on critical aspects like uptime, customer support, and security measures. Consistent praise or criticism in these areas can provide a clearer picture of the provider’s strengths and weaknesses. Additionally, look for reviews that discuss specific experiences, such as the efficiency of the support team in resolving issues or the stability of the hosting during high traffic periods.
It’s also beneficial to seek out testimonials from businesses or websites similar to yours. Their experiences can offer a more relevant perspective on how the hosting service might perform under similar conditions. For example, an e-commerce site will have different requirements compared to a personal blog, and understanding how the provider meets these varied needs is crucial.
While individual reviews can sometimes be subjective, patterns in the feedback often reveal more about the service’s overall performance. Pay attention to how recent the reviews are, as they reflect the current state of the provider’s services and customer support.
In conclusion, taking the time to thoroughly research reviews and testimonials can equip you with the knowledge needed to make a well-informed decision. This due diligence ensures that you select a web hosting provider capable of supporting your website’s success and growth.